Our goal is to present one of our flagship products to the general public through a polished, professional brochure that immediately communicates value and trust. I already have the core product details, high-resolution images, brand colours, and logo files; what’s missing is a cohesive layout and compelling copy that pull everything together.
Here’s how I see the workflow:
• Concept & layout: Create a clear, visually engaging structure—tri-fold or bi-fold is fine as long as it supports a smooth story flow.
• Copy refinement: Take my rough notes and shape them into concise, benefit-driven headlines and body text suited to a broad consumer audience.
• Design execution: Apply our brand palette, integrate the imagery, and keep typography modern yet easy to read. Adobe InDesign or Illustrator are preferred so we have fully editable files later.
• Final artwork: Supply a print-ready PDF (CMYK, 300 dpi, bleeds) plus the packaged source files.
Acceptance criteria
– Professional tone throughout, no jargon or industry-only language.
– High-contrast visuals that remain consistent with our existing brand guidelines.
– All links, fonts, and images properly embedded or included in the source package.
